Our laboratory and field testing services satisfy material testing requirements for any soil related construction activity. Our field and laboratory technicians are supported by a team of professional geotechnical engineers. We provide:

Our team of geotechnical engineering specialists collects field data, apply theoretical principals, consider practical experience, and provide cost effective alternatives to our client. Our objective is to facilitate your project with sound, practical, and buildable solutions.
